Transplantation of Human Umbilical Cord Blood-Derived Cellular Fraction Improves LV Function and Remodeling after Myocardial Ischemia/Reperfusion.

CONCLUSIONS: Transplantation of hUCB-derived CD45- Lin- nonhematopoietic cellular subfraction after a reperfused MI in nonimmunosuppressed rats ameliorates LV dysfunction and improves remodeling via favorable paracrine modulation of molecular pathways. These findings with human cells in a clinically relevant model of myocardial ischemia/reperfusion in immunocompetent animals may have significant translational implications.
